save up to 80 percent
how to search
 
Search millions of books and Textbooks!


Browse by Category
Computers & TechnologyComputer ScienceSoftware Engineering
     Sub Categories

Design Tools & Techniques
Information Systems
Methodology
Multimedia Information Systems

  
book image
Sell Book

Code Complete: A Practical Handbook of Software Construction, Second Edition
Author: Steve McConnell
ISBN-10: 0735619670
ISBN-13: 9780735619678
Published: 2004-07-07
Publisher: Microsoft Press

Book Description:
Widely considered one of the best practical guides to programming, Steve McConnell’s original CODE COMPLETE has been helping developers write better software for more than a decade. Now this classic book has been fully updated and revised with leading-edge practices—and hundreds of new code samples—illustrating the art and science of software construction. Capturing the body of knowledge available from research, academia, and everyday commercial practice, McConnell synthesizes the most effective techniques and must-know principles into clear, pragmatic guidance. No matter what your experience level, development environment, or project size, this book will inform and stimulate your thinking—and help you build the highest quality code.Discover the timeless techniques and strategies that help you: Design for minimum complexity and maximum creativity Reap the benefits of collaborative development Apply defensive programming techniques to reduce and flush out errors Exploit opportunities to refactor—or evolve—code, and do it safely Use construction practices that are right-weight for your project Debug problems quickly and effectively Resolve critical construction issues early and correctly Build quality into the beginning, middle, and end of your project
OR
compare book prices

book image
Sell Book

Code: The Hidden Language of Computer Hardware and Software
Author: Charles Petzold
ISBN-10: 0735611319
ISBN-13: 9780735611313
Published: 2000-11-11
Publisher: Microsoft Press

Book Description:
What do flashlights, the British invasion, black cats, and seesaws have to do with computers? In CODE, they show us the ingenious ways we manipulate language and invent new means of communicating with each other. And through CODE, we see how this ingenuity and our very human compulsion to communicate have driven the technological innovations of the past two centuries.Using everyday objects and familiar language systems such as Braille and Morse code, author Charles Petzold weaves an illuminating narrative for anyone who’s ever wondered about the secret inner life of computers and other smart machines.It’s a cleverly illustrated and eminently comprehensible story—and along the way, you’ll discover you’ve gained a real context for understanding today’s world of PCs, digital media, and the Internet. No matter what your level of technical savvy, CODE will charm you—and perhaps even awaken the technophile within.
OR
compare book prices

book image
Sell Book

Design Patterns: Elements of Reusable Object-Oriented Software
Author: Erich Gamma
ISBN-10: 0201633612
ISBN-13: 9780201633610
Published: 1994-11-10
Publisher: Addison-Wesley Professional

Book Description:
* Capturing a wealth of experience about the design of object-oriented software, four top-notch designers present a catalog of simple and succinct solutions to commonly occurring design problems. Previously undocumented, these 23 patterns allow designers to create more flexible, elegant, and ultimately reusable designs without having to rediscover the design solutions themselves. * The authors begin by describing what patterns are and how they can help you design object-oriented software. They then go on to systematically name, explain, evaluate, and catalog recurring designs in object-oriented systems. With Design Patterns as your guide, you will learn how these important patterns fit into the software development process, and how you can leverage them to solve your own design problems most efficiently.
OR
compare book prices

book image
Sell Book

Microsoft SharePoint 2010 Plain & Simple: Learn the simplest ways to get things done with Microsoft SharePoint 2010
Author: Johnathan Lightfoot
ISBN-10: 0735642281
ISBN-13: 9780735642287
Published: 2010-11-08
Publisher: Microsoft Press

Book Description:
Learn the simplest ways to get things done with Microsoft® SharePoint® 2010!Here's WHAT You'll LearnManage and share team information in one location Use project task lists to organize people and processes Create libraries for documents, media, slides, and more Work seamlessly with Microsoft Office Find content quickly with the Search Center Add SharePoint blogs, wikis, and personal sites Here's HOW You’ll Learn ItJump in whenever you need answers Easy-to-follow STEPS and SCREENSHOTS show exactly what to do Handy TIPS teach new techniques and shortcuts Quick TRY THIS! exercises help apply what you learn right away
OR
compare book prices

book image
Sell Book

The Mythical Man-Month: Essays on Software Engineering, Anniversary Edition (2nd Edition)
Author: Frederick P. Brooks
ISBN-10: 0201835959
ISBN-13: 9780201835953
Published: 1995-08-12
Publisher: Addison-Wesley Professional

Book Description:
Few books on software project management have been as influential and timeless as The Mythical Man-Month. With a blend of software engineering facts and thought-provoking opinions, Fred Brooks offers insight for anyone managing complex projects. These essays draw from his experience as project manager for the IBM System/360 computer family and then for OS/360, its massive software system. Now, 20 years after the initial publication of his book, Brooks has revisited his original ideas and added new thoughts and advice, both for readers already familiar with his work and for readers discovering it for the first time.   The added chapters contain (1) a crisp condensation of all the propositions asserted in the original book, including Brooks' central argument in The Mythical Man-Month: that large programming projects suffer management problems different from small ones due to the division of labor; that the conceptual integrity of the product is therefore critical; and that it is difficult but possible to achieve this unity; (2) Brooks' view of these propositions a generation later; (3) a reprint of his classic 1986 paper "No Silver Bullet"; and (4) today's thoughts on the 1986 assertion, "There will be no silver bullet within ten years."
OR
compare book prices

book image
Sell Book

Information Dashboard Design: The Effective Visual Communication of Data
Author: Stephen Few
ISBN-10: 0596100167
ISBN-13: 9780596100162
Published: 2006-01-01
Publisher: O'Reilly Media

Book Description:
Dashboards have become popular in recent years as uniquely powerful tools for communicating important information at a glance. Although dashboards are potentially powerful, this potential is rarely realized. The greatest display technology in the world won't solve this if you fail to use effective visual design. And if a dashboard fails to tell you precisely what you need to know in an instant, you'll never use it, even if it's filled with cute gauges, meters, and traffic lights. Don't let your investment in dashboard technology go to waste. This book will teach you the visual design skills you need to create dashboards that communicate clearly, rapidly, and compellingly. Information Dashboard Design will explain how to: Avoid the thirteen mistakes common to dashboard design Provide viewers with the information they need quickly and clearly Apply what we now know about visual perception to the visual presentation of information Minimize distractions, cliches, and unnecessary embellishments that create confusion Organize business information to support meaning and usability Create an aesthetically pleasing viewing experience Maintain consistency of design to provide accurate interpretation Optimize the power of dashboard technology by pairing it with visual effectiveness Stephen Few has over 20 years of experience as an IT innovator, consultant, and educator. As Principal of the consultancy Perceptual Edge, Stephen focuses on data visualization for analyzing and communicating quantitative business information. He provides consulting and training services, speaks frequently at conferences, and teaches in the MBA program at the University of California in Berkeley. He is also the author of Show Me the Numbers: Designing Tables and Graphs to Enlighten.
OR
compare book prices

book image
Sell Book

Management Information Systems (12th Edition)
Author: Kenneth C. Laudon
ISBN-10: 0132142856
ISBN-13: 9780132142854
Published: 2011-01-14
Publisher: Prentice Hall

Book Description:
Management Information Systems provides comprehensive and integrative coverage of essential new technologies, information system applications, and their impact on business models and managerial decision-making in an exciting and interactive manner. The twelfth edition focuses on the major changes that have been made in information technology over the past two years, and includes new opening, closing, and Interactive Session cases.
OR
compare book prices

book image
Sell Book

CISSP All-in-One Exam Guide, Fifth Edition
Author: Shon Harris
ISBN-10: 0071602178
ISBN-13: 9780071602174
Published: 2010-01-15
Publisher: McGraw-Hill Osborne Media

Book Description:
Get complete coverage of the latest release of the Certified Information Systems Security Professional (CISSP) exam inside this comprehensive, fully updated resource. Written by the leading expert in IT security certification and training, this authoritative guide covers all 10 CISSP exam domains developed by the International Information Systems Security Certification Consortium (ISC2). You'll find learning objectives at the beginning of each chapter, exam tips, practice exam questions, and in-depth explanations. Designed to help you pass the CISSP exam with ease, this definitive volume also serves as an essential on-the-job reference. COVERS ALL 10 CISSP DOMAINS: Information security and risk management Access control Security architecture and design Physical and environmental security Telecommunications and network security Cryptography Business continuity and disaster recovery planning Legal regulations, compliance, and investigations Application security Operations security THE CD-ROM FEATURES: Hundreds of practice exam questions Video training excerpt from the author E-book Shon Harris, CISSP, is a security consultant, a former member of the Information Warfare unit in the Air Force, and a contributing writer to Information Security Magazine and Windows 2000 Magazine. She is the author of the previous editions of this book.
OR
compare book prices

book image
Sell Book

Agile Estimating and Planning
Author: Mike Cohn
ISBN-10: 0131479415
ISBN-13: 9780131479418
Published: 2005-11-11
Publisher: Prentice Hall

Book Description:
Praise for Agile Estimating and Planning "Traditional, deterministic approaches to planning and estimating simply don't cut it on the slippery slopes of today's dynamic, change-driven projects. Mike Cohn's breakthrough book gives us not only the philosophy, but also the guidelines and a proven set of tools that we need to succeed in planning, estimating, and scheduling projects with a high uncertainty factor. At the same time, the author never loses sight of the need to deliver business value to the customer each step of the way." —Doug DeCarlo, author of eXtreme Project Management: Using Leadership, Principles and Tools to Deliver Value in the Face of Volatility (Jossey-Bass, 2004) "We know how to build predictive plans and manage them. But building plans that only estimate the future and then embrace change, challenge most of our training and skills. In Agile Estimating and Planning, Mike Cohn once again fills a hole in the Agile practices, this time by showing us a workable approach to Agile estimating and planning. Mike delves into the nooks and crannies of the subject and anticipates many of the questions and nuances of this topic. Students of Agile processes will recognize that this book is truly about agility, bridging many of the practices between Scrum and ExtremeProgramming." —Ken Schwaber, Scrum evangelist, Agile Alliance cofounder, and signatory to the Agile Manifesto "In Agile Estimating and Planning, Mike Cohn has, for the first time, brought together most everything that the Agile community has learned about the subject. The book is clear, well organized, and a pleasant and valuable read. It goes into all the necessary detail, and at the same time keeps the reader's burden low. We can dig in as deeply as we need to, without too much detail before we need it. The book really brings together everything we have learned about Agile estimation and planning over the past decade. It will serve its readers well." —Ron Jeffries, www.XProgramming.com, author of Extreme Programming Installed (Addison-Wesley, 2001) and Extreme Programming Adventures in C# (Microsoft Press, 2004) "Agile Estimating and Planning provides a view of planning that's balanced between theory and practice, and it is supported by enough concrete experiences to lend it credibility. I particularly like the quote 'planning is a quest for value.' It points to a new, more positive attitude toward planning that goes beyond the 'necessary evil' view that I sometimes hold." —Kent Beck, author of Extreme Programming Explained, Second Edition (Addison-Wesley, 2005) "Up-front planning is still the most critical part of software development. Agile software development requires Agile planning techniques. This book shows you how to employ Agile planning in a succinct, practical, and easy-to-follow manner." —Adam Rogers, Ultimate Software "Mike does a great follow-up to User Stories Applied by continuing to provide Agile teams with the practical approaches and techniques to increase agility. In this book, Mike provides time-proven and well-tested methods for being successful with the multiple levels of planning and estimating required by Agile. This book is the first to detail the disciplines of Agile estimating and planning, in ways that rival my 1980 civil engineering texts on CPM Planning and Estimating." —Ryan Martens, President and Founder, Rally Software Development Corporation "With insight and clarity, Mike Cohn shows how to effectively produce software of high business value. With Agile estimation and planning, you focus effort where it really counts, and continue to do so as circumstances change." —Rick Mugridge, Rimu Research Ltd., and lead author, Fit for Developing Software (Prentice Hall, 2005) "Finally! The groundbreaking book my clients have been clamoring for! Agile Estimating and Planning demystifies the process of defining, driving, and delivering great software that matters to the business. Mike's clarity, insight, and experience leap out through every page of this book, offering an approach that is relevant and immediately useful to all members of an Agile project." —Kert D. Peterson, President, Enterprise Agile Group, LLC "This isn't yet another generic book on Agile software development. Agile Estimating and Planning fills a gap left by most of the other books and gives you important, practical, down-to-earth techniques needed to be successful on Agile development projects." —Steve Tockey, Principal Consultant, Construx Software "Estimation, planning, and tracking is a trinity. If you don't do one of them, you don't need the other two. This book provides very practical knowledge for estimation, planning, prioritizing, and tracking. It should be compulsory subject matter for project managers and their teams, even if they hesitate to call themselves Agile." —Niels Malotaux, Project Coach "Effective planning is an important, but often misunderstood, part of any successful Agile project. With Agile Estimating and Planning, Mike Cohn has given us a definitive guide to a wide range of Agile estimating and planning practices. With his clear and practical style, Mike not only explains how to successfully get started planning an Agile project, but also provides a wealth of tips and advice for improving any team's Agile planning process. This book is a must-read for managers, coaches, and members of Agile teams." —Paul Hodgetts, Agile coach and CEO, Agile Logic "Mike's writing style captures the essence of agility-just the right amount of information to bring clarity to the reader. This book provides an excellent guide for all Agile practitioners, both seasoned and novice." —Robert Holler, President and CEO, VersionOne, LLC "It is as if Mike took the distilled knowledge regarding planning and estimation of a great Agile developer (which he is) and laid out all he knows in an easily understandable manner. More importantly, he has a great mix of concepts with real-world examples finished off with a case study so the reader can relate the information to their own situation. Unless you are already an expert Agile planner and estimator, this book is for you."—Alan Shalloway, CEO, Senior Consultant, Net Objectives, and coauthor of Design Patterns Explained, Second Edition (Addison-Wesley, 2005)"Although I had plenty of XP experience before trying out Mike Cohn's Agile planning practices, the effectiveness of the practical and proven techniques in this book blew me away! The book recognizes that people, not tools or processes, produce great software, and that teams benefit most by learning about their project and their product as they go. The examples in the book are concrete, easily grasped, and simply reek of common sense. This book will help teams (whether Agile or not) deliver more value, more often, and have fun doing it! Whether you're a manager or a programmer, a tester or a CEO, part of an Agile team, or just looking for a way to stamp out chaos and death marches, this book will guide you." —Lisa Crispin, coauthor of Testing Extreme Programming (Addison-Wesley, 2003) "Mike Cohn does an excellent job demonstrating how an Agile approach can address issues of risk and uncertainty in order to provide more meaningful estimates and plans for software projects." —Todd Little, Senior Development Manager, Landmark Graphics "Mike Cohn explains his approach to Agile planning, and shows how 'critical chain' thinking can be used to effectively buffer both schedule and features. As with User Stories Applied, this book is easy to read and grounded in real-world experience." —Bill Wake, author of Refactoring Workbook (Addison-Wesley, 2003) "Mike brings this book to life with real-world examples that help reveal how and why an Agile approach works for planning software development projects. This book has great breadth, ranging from the fundamentals of release planning to advanced topics such as financial aspects of prioritization. I can see this book becoming an invaluable aid to Agile project managers, as it provides a wealth of practical tips such as how to set iteration length and boot-strap velocity, and communicate progress." —Rachel Davies, Independent Consultant "There has been a need for a solid, pragmatic book on the long-term vision of an Agile Project for project managers. Agile Estimating and Planning addresses this need. It's not theory—this book contains project-tested practices that have been used on Agile projects. As Mike's test subjects, we applied these practices to the development of video games (one of the most unpredictable project environments you can imagine) with success." —Clinton Keith, Chief Technical Officer, High Moon Studios "When I first heard Mike Cohn speak, I was impressed by a rare combination of qualities: deep experience and understanding in modern iterative and Agile methods; a drive to find and validate easy, high-impact solutions beyond the status quo of traditional (usually ineffective) methods; and the passion and clarity of a natural coach. These qualities are evident in this wonderful, practical guide. I estimate you won't be disappointed in studying and applying his advice." —Craig Larman, Chief Scientist, Valtech, and author of Applying UML and Patterns, Third Edition (Prentice Hall, 2005) and Agile and Iterative Development (Addison-Wesley, 2004)"Agile Estimating and Planning is a critical guide on how to successfully provide value to customers of IT services. This book is filled with clear examples that are essential—from project team...
OR
compare book prices

book image
Sell Book

Enterprise Integration Patterns: Designing, Building, and Deploying Messaging Solutions
Author: Gregor Hohpe
ISBN-10: 0321200683
ISBN-13: 9780321200686
Published: 2003-10-20
Publisher: Addison-Wesley Professional

Book Description:
*Would you like to use a consistent visual notation for drawing integration solutions? Look inside the front cover. *Do you want to harness the power of asynchronous systems without getting caught in the pitfalls? See "Thinking Asynchronously" in the Introduction. *Do you want to know which style of application integration is best for your purposes? See Chapter 2, Integration Styles. *Do you want to learn techniques for processing messages concurrently? See Chapter 10, Competing Consumers and Message Dispatcher. *Do you want to learn how you can track asynchronous messages as they flow across distributed systems? See Chapter 11, Message History and Message Store. *Do you want to understand how a system designed using integration patterns can be implemented using Java Web services, .NET message queuing, and a TIBCO-based publish-subscribe architecture? See Chapter 9, Interlude: Composed Messaging. Utilizing years of practical experience, seasoned experts Gregor Hohpe and Bobby Woolf show how asynchronous messaging has proven to be the best strategy for enterprise integration success. However, building and deploying messaging solutions presents a number of problems for developers.Enterprise Integration Patterns provides an invaluable catalog of sixty-five patterns, with real-world solutions that demonstrate the formidable of messaging and help you to design effective messaging solutions for your enterprise. The authors also include examples covering a variety of different integration technologies, such as JMS, MSMQ, TIBCO ActiveEnterprise, Microsoft BizTalk, SOAP, and XSL. A case study describing a bond trading system illustrates the patterns in practice, and the book offers a look at emerging standards, as well as insights into what the future of enterprise integration might hold. This book provides a consistent vocabulary and visual notation framework to describe large-scale integration solutions across many technologies. It also explores in detail the advantages and limitations of asynchronous messaging architectures. The authors present practical advice on designing code that connects an application to a messaging system, and provide extensive information to help you determine when to send a message, how to route it to the proper destination, and how to monitor the health of a messaging system.If you want to know how to manage, monitor, and maintain a messaging system once it is in use, get this book. 0321200683B09122003
OR
compare book prices

next

 
bookstores we search

Script Execution Time: 0.868 seconds